## Runbook: Payroll Export Format Change — Account Recovery Step

After the Greywage v3 export switch, some finance accounts were locked when the old column layout failed validation. If a user reports a locked export account, first confirm they're on the v3 template, then reset their export profile in the admin console. To complete the reset, authenticate to the recovery console with the passphrase listed below.

unlock words, tawif-tahop: oliys-ulawyn-tamdor-lamys-casox-jormir-fraius-kasath-ulador-ulamir-holir-sorys-holeth

# Session Handling — Brimflow Queue-Depth Autoscaler

The autoscaler holds a single authenticated session against the Brimflow control plane. Sessions expire after 30 minutes of inactivity; the reconciler refreshes them on each poll. If scaling decisions stall, check that the session heartbeat is landing — a stale session causes the depth metric to read zero and the scaler to drain workers.

To re-establish the session manually during an incident, call the auth endpoint on the control-plane node using the on-call bearer token below.

session JWT of yawep-yawep = eyJhbGciOiJIUzI1NiIsInR5cCI6IkpXVCJ9.eyJzdWIiOiI3pWF3_In0.aXYsHiog

**ALERT: DOCLINT_GATE_FAILURE — Quillcheck**

Severity: medium. This alert fires when the Quillcheck documentation linter blocks a release candidate because one or more changed pages fail structural validation — typically missing ownership headers, broken cross-references, or stale version stamps. The release pipeline will not proceed until every flagged page passes or receives an explicit waiver from the docs steward. Please review the lint report before granting any waiver. The waiver procedure and current rule catalogue are documented here.

operations page: https://jira.lumiclabs.internal/pages/display/projects/af69ce92